Doulas are trained in supplying psychological and physical support prior to, throughout, and after the birth procedure. Unlike midwives that are signed up nurses, doulas aren't professional specialists able to suggest medicine, yet they provide important physical and emotional assistance. Doulas commonly join the birthing person in their 2nd or 3rd trimester to address questions concerning the birthing procedure and establish a birth strategy.


Postpartum, doulas can assist with nursing education and learning and offer useful assistance, mentor family members exactly how to take care of their newborn infant. Research studies reveal that doula assistance reduces the demand for C-sections and pain medicine, thus causing quicker and easier recovery for birthing moms and dads. Doula advice has actually been shown to minimize early shipments and length of labor, and the psychological support they provide commonly lowers anxiousness and anxiety, especially in the labor procedure.

In 2011, a substantial studythe largest organized evaluation of continuous labor supportdemonstrated the effects of having a doula for over 15,000 women that joined 21 randomized controlled trials.
